
The Tennessee House Has Unanimously Passed Evelyn Boswell’s Law. The Bill Is Now Headed To Governor Bill Lee For His Signature. The Bill Was Sponsored By State Representative John Crawford. It Will Increase Penalties For Parents Or Guardians Who Fail To Report Their Children Missing Within 48 Hours. Boswell Was Found Dead On A Relative’s Property After No One Reported Her Missing For Nearly Two Months. Her Mother, Megan Boswell Is Charged In The Toddler’s Death.
